- The distance between Souda/ Khania, Greece and Inchon, North Korea is approximately 8,639 km or 5,368 mi.
- To reach Souda/ Khania in this distance one would set out from Inchon bearing 305.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Souda/ Khania bearing 232.5° or SW .
- Souda/ Khania has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Inchon has a hot summer continental climate with dry winters (Dwa).
- Souda/ Khania is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Inchon is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 6.7 °C (12.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.4 °C (22.3°F) less in Souda/ Khania.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 518.2 mm (20.4 in) less which is equivalent to 518.2 l/m² (12.72 US gal/ft²) or 5,182,000 l/ha (553,990 US gal/ac) less. About 5/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2° higher in Souda/ Khania than in Inchon.
- Relative humidity levels are 7.6%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4.3°C (7.8°F) higher.
